Teach Live is a participant project in which one or more school participate in direct communication with the people in Earthbound 3. From each school site students will investigate and communicate about a specified location and project. This project involves Mongolia and the endangered sheep known as Argali.

Worksheets for Mongolia Project

Students are working on these worksheets in class, with parts of them assigned as homework. They are designed to help familiarize students with Mongolia and with aspects of the geography and project. (Below each Assignment is an example of a completed worksheet)
